Michael Ferris
|
cf71a962c1
Merge 1809 October Update changes
|
%!s(int64=7) %!d(string=hai) anos |
Irina Yatsenko
|
b7294422e9
Remove unused CloseSources and related methods
|
%!s(int64=7) %!d(string=hai) anos |
Curtis Man
|
0353d20b74
Reduced memory usage by management of keeping alive property record referenced by function body.
|
%!s(int64=7) %!d(string=hai) anos |
Oguz Bastemur
|
4efbffbc2d
[1.7>master] [MERGE #3501 @obastemur] Perf Improvements
|
%!s(int64=8) %!d(string=hai) anos |
Oguz Bastemur
|
960f8e34d0
Update hashing algorithm to FNV-1a
|
%!s(int64=8) %!d(string=hai) anos |
Curtis Man
|
6eb44575a5
Byte code size and serialized byte code size optimizations (15-20% serialized byte code size reduction)
|
%!s(int64=8) %!d(string=hai) anos |
Curtis Man
|
105b8f205f
Experimental: Introduce "lite" ChakraCore build
|
%!s(int64=8) %!d(string=hai) anos |
Taylor Woll
|
abf54edffc
Remove Utf8SourceInfo::RetrieveSourceText since it is dead code
|
%!s(int64=8) %!d(string=hai) anos |
Mark Marron
|
1945e02ef9
TTD -- Updates to debug integration and log optimization.
|
%!s(int64=8) %!d(string=hai) anos |
Kunal Pathak
|
695c870086
Reduce memory consumption of Utf8SourceInfo objects
|
%!s(int64=9) %!d(string=hai) anos |
Paul Leathers
|
3d3cfa0790
Fix build break in master
|
%!s(int64=9) %!d(string=hai) anos |
Paul Leathers
|
31814ff0a9
[1.4>master] [MERGE #2470 @pleath] Fix inconsistency in F12 rundown/reparse after redeferral.
|
%!s(int64=9) %!d(string=hai) anos |
Paul Leathers
|
14b97eb015
Fix inconsistency in F12 rundown/reparse after redeferral. F12 rundown/reparse counts on having function bodies stay around so that top-level functions can be discovered and reparsed. With the changes in redeferral, and making the function body dictionary into a LeafValueDictionary, function bodies can be discarded, so the functions that appear to be top-level at reparse time are missing information about enclosing scopes. Fix this by detecting top-level functions at byte code gen time and reparsing them even if they've been kicked out of the dictionary.
|
%!s(int64=9) %!d(string=hai) anos |
Taylor Woll
|
2cc67e4cc9
[1.4>master] [MERGE #2396 @boingoing] Some string APIs operating on UTF-8 buffers do not property compute the length of the UTF-8 buffer in bytes
|
%!s(int64=9) %!d(string=hai) anos |
Taylor Woll
|
f85beb7c04
Add unit tests, refactor to remove DecodeInto variants from Utf8Codex
|
%!s(int64=9) %!d(string=hai) anos |
Taylor Woll
|
de4659a4a6
Some string APIs operating on UTF-8 buffers do not property compute the length of the UTF-8 buffer in bytes
|
%!s(int64=9) %!d(string=hai) anos |
Jianchun Xu
|
3d72466243
Merge remote-tracking branch 'master' into swb
|
%!s(int64=9) %!d(string=hai) anos |
Kunal Pathak
|
1f0ebb2e05
Change non-leaf to leaf
|
%!s(int64=9) %!d(string=hai) anos |
Jianchun Xu
|
c6bf63b2d6
swb: annotate nested field type, union
|
%!s(int64=9) %!d(string=hai) anos |
Jianchun Xu
|
d7f2c06a62
swb: write barrier annotations 3
|
%!s(int64=9) %!d(string=hai) anos |
Jianchun Xu
|
6d36a6f737
swb: write barrier annotations 2
|
%!s(int64=9) %!d(string=hai) anos |
Oguz Bastemur
|
f7f7132248
Jsrt: new string API
|
%!s(int64=9) %!d(string=hai) anos |
Ed Maurer
|
ab0f8c40a8
The ScriptEngine::Clone method was used to support an old host technology, HTC.
|
%!s(int64=9) %!d(string=hai) anos |
Sandeep Agarwal
|
86f184672f
Remove hybrid debugging support
|
%!s(int64=9) %!d(string=hai) anos |
Hitesh Kanwathirtha
|
7453224eec
Clean up inline usage
|
%!s(int64=10) %!d(string=hai) anos |
Jianchun Xu
|
cec0e9a84f
replace wchar_t/L"..." with char16/_u("...")
|
%!s(int64=10) %!d(string=hai) anos |
Sandeep Agarwal
|
d0925e14f3
Determine debug mode based on per script/source instead of ScriptContext
|
%!s(int64=10) %!d(string=hai) anos |
Jianchun Xu
|
47eab483b9
change top-level dir Lib back to lib
|
%!s(int64=10) %!d(string=hai) anos |
Jianchun Xu
|
4e05cc2969
rename /lib/ files to CamelCase
|
%!s(int64=10) %!d(string=hai) anos |
ChakraBot
|
5d8406741f
Initial commit
|
%!s(int64=10) %!d(string=hai) anos |